Excelで時間から特定の部分(例:16:45)を抽出する方法

Office系ソフトウェア

Excelで日付と時刻が一つのセルに入っている場合、特定の部分を抽出したいことがあります。例えば、’1900/1/1 16:45:00′ から、’16:45′ の部分だけを取り出したいとき、どのような方法を使うべきでしょうか?この記事では、Excelで時間の一部を抽出するための簡単な方法を紹介します。

時間を抽出する方法:MID関数の使用

まず、MID関数を使って特定の部分を抽出する方法について説明します。MID関数は文字列の一部を抽出する関数ですが、日付と時間が一緒になっているセルから時間だけを抜き出すには、適切な位置を指定する必要があります。

MID関数の構文は以下の通りです。

MID(文字列, 開始位置, 文字数)

時間部分を抽出するための具体的な手順

時間だけを抽出するために、次の手順を踏んでいきます。

  • まず、時間の部分は通常、セル内での開始位置が12文字目から始まります(例:’1900/1/1 16:45:00′ の ’16:45:00′ の部分)。
  • 次に、抽出する文字数は、’16:45′ のように5文字を指定します。
  • このように、MID関数を以下のように使用します:
MID(A1, 12, 5)

これにより、A1セルに含まれる日付と時刻から、’16:45′ の部分だけを取り出すことができます。

具体例:MID関数で時間を抽出する

例として、セルA1に ‘1900/1/1 16:45:00’ という日付と時間が入力されている場合、次のように入力します。

MID(A1, 12, 5)

この関数を使用することで、’16:45′ の部分だけを簡単に抽出できます。

日付と時間を別々に管理する方法

Excelでは日付と時間を別々に管理する方法もあります。日付と時間が同じセルに入力されていると、時々問題が発生します。もし日付と時間を分けて管理したい場合は、以下の方法を使います。

  • 日付部分を抽出するには、INT関数を使用します。例:
INT(A1)

これにより、日付部分だけを取り出すことができます。

  • 時間部分を抽出するには、MOD関数を使用します。例:
MOD(A1, 1)

これにより、時間だけを抽出することができます。

まとめ:時間部分を抽出するための最適な方法

Excelで日付と時間が含まれるセルから、時間部分だけを抽出するには、MID関数を使って文字列から必要な部分を切り取るのが最も簡単です。また、日付と時間を別々に管理する場合は、INT関数やMOD関数を活用すると良いでしょう。

これらの方法を使って、Excelでの作業を効率化しましょう。

コメント

タイトルとURLをコピーしました